No, Cialis is not a blood thinner.
Blood vessels carrying blood to the penis relax, which allows sufficient amount of blood to create an erection.
If the body also produces phosphodiesterase type 5 (PDE5), then the flow of blood can be reduced or eliminated.
Cialis works by preventing the body from producing PDE5, which then allows blood to flow to the penis.
